Weekends in Pentecost

The church year is divided into two parts – a festival half that centers around Christmas and Easter, and a non-festival half that begins after Pentecost.  We are in that second half of the church year where our focus is on the growth of the individual believer and the growth of the church.  So we focus on the life giving words and works of our Lord Jesus.  The Pentecost season runs from Pentecost (June 4) up to the beginning of the new church year in Advent (December 3).
